I\u2019ve seen them reply in under 3 minutes.)<\/p>\n<p><h2>Questions and Answers:  <\/h2>\n<\/p>\n<p><h4>How do bingo casino sites ensure fair gameplay for players?<\/h4>\n<\/p>\n<p>Reputable bingo casino sites use certified random number generators (RNGs) to determine the outcome of each game. These systems are regularly tested by independent auditing firms to confirm they operate without bias. Players can usually access reports or certificates from these audits, which show that results are truly random and not manipulated. Additionally, many sites display game history or results transparency tools, allowing users to verify outcomes over time. This level of oversight helps maintain trust and ensures that every player has an equal chance to win.<\/p>\n<p><h4>Are there any restrictions on who can play at bingo casino sites?<\/h4>\n<\/p>\n<p>Yes, there are legal and age-related restrictions. These offers are designed to attract new users and encourage ongoing engagement, though terms like wagering requirements and game restrictions often apply.<\/p>\n<p><h4>How can I tell if a bingo casino site is safe to use?<\/h4>\n<\/p>\n<p>Look for clear licensing information from recognized gambling authorities like the UK Gambling Commission, Malta Gaming Authority, or Curacao eGaming. A trustworthy site will display this license prominently, often in the footer. Secure connections (HTTPS) and encrypted payment methods are also signs of reliability. Reading independent reviews from real users can reveal common issues like delayed withdrawals or poor customer service. Avoid sites that ask for excessive personal information or lack transparency about their operations.<\/p>\n<p>7A27220F<img src=\"https:\/\/www.istockphoto.com\/photos\/class=\" style=\"max-width:420px;float:left;padding:10px 10px 10px 0px;border:0px;\"><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>\u0417 Bingo Casino Sites Overview Explore reputable bingo casino sites offering secure gameplay, diverse games, and reliable bonuses.
